摘要
We collected 103 clinical Enterococcus faecium isolates from across Canada, performed standard broth microdilution susceptibility testing, and compared these results with results from the MicroScan Pos MIC Type 6 panel (Baxter Health Care Corp., West Sacramento, Calif.) and the AMS-Vitek Gram-Positive Susceptibility card (Vitek Inc., St. Louis, Mo.). High-level aminoglycoside resistance to gentamicin and streptomycin was detected by a single-concentration agar method with 1,000-mu-g of each aminoglycoside per ml. In addition, we tested the effect of the lower calcium content in broth media as recommended in National Committee for Clinical Laboratory Standards (NCCLS) guideline M7-A2 on the activity of the highly calcium-dependent agent daptomycin. Of the 103 E. faecium isolates, there were 4 and 30 isolates with high-level gentamicin resistance (HLGR) and high-level streptomycin resistance (HLSR), respectively. An additional 39 (37 with HLGR and 36 with HLSR) E. faecium isolates were tested by both the MicroScan and the AMS-Vitek systems. The AMS-Vitek card demonstrated sensitivities of 95 and 82% for detecting HLGR strains and HLSR strains, respectively. The MicroScan panel demonstrated improved sensitivities for detecting HLGR (42 to 97%) and HLSR (64 to 84%) when readings were performed manually instead of being generated automatically. Ampicillin resistance (MIC, greater-than-or-equal-to 16-mu-g/ml) was detected in 23 of the 103 E. faecium isolates. Only 14 and 20 of these were detected by the MicroSCan panels and AMS-Vitek cards, respectively. Beta-Lactamase activity was not detected in any isolates. The lower calcium content in broth media recommended by NCCLS guideline M7-A2 markedly reduced the in vitro activity of daptomycin against Enterococcus spp.
